Summary
Fouad Husseini is a seasoned insurance and InsurTech executive with eight years focused on digital transformation and over three decades in insurance operations, strategy and claims. As Regional Director of Business Development at the Open Insurance Initiative and former Head of Business Development at Boubyan Takaful, he has led partnerships, market entry projects and API/data standard work that underpin open finance adoption. A Fellow of the Chartered Insurance Institute and author of The Insurance Field Book, he combines technical rigor from an aeronautical engineering background with deep domain expertise in risk, reinsurance and regulatory setups. He has a track record of turning loss-making units profitable through process re-engineering and led complex strategic projects including UK branch setup and reinsurance licensing. Active in community building and thought leadership, he built a 300+ organization OPIN network and is a regular writer on digital economy and open innovation. Less obvious: he pairs negotiation training from INSEAD with hands-on claims and engineering experience, giving him unusual fluency across technical, commercial and regulatory conversations.
